These are photos from concerts where Atomic Drop played, so they may be of other bands that played the concert as well.
Glastonbury Festival 2011
Jun 22 - 26, 2011
Pilton, England, United Kingdom
Uploaded by A Badger Faced Man
Guilfest 2010
Jul 16 - 18, 2010
Guildford, England, United Kingdom
Uploaded by Craig Hatfield